Abstract
Different methods for the synthesis of iron carbene complexes or their precursors have been summarized. New diastereomerically pure carbene precursors RR-(+)- and SS-(−)-(η5-C5H5)(CO)2FeCH(OSiMe3)[η6-o-CH3OC6H4Cr(CO)3] have been prepared by the reaction of the Fp anion with enantiomerically pure S-(+) or R-(−)-o-anisaldehyde(tricarbonyl)chromium complexes. They were then converted to the corresponding iron carbene complexes S- and R-[(η5-C5H5)(CO)2FeCH[(η6-o-CH3OC6H4)Cr(CO)3]]+. Enantioselective carbene transfers from these complexes to 2-methylpropene, 1,1-diphenylethylene, styrene, p-methylstyrene, p-chlorostyrene, and p-trifluoromethylstyrene gave o-methoxyphenylcyclopropanes with high diastereoselectivities and moderate to excellent enantioselectivities.
